How much do financial planning analysis int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for financial planning analysis intern in Raleigh, NC is $19.30,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.59 and $21.73 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Financial Planning Analysis Intern do?

A Financial Planning Analysis (FP&A) Intern supports the finance team in analyzing financial data, creating reports, and assisting with budgeting and forecasting. They help gather and interpret financial information to give insights into company performance and trends. Typically, their tasks include preparing financial models, reviewing variances from budgets, and working with spreadsheets and presentation tools. This role is a great way to gain hands-on experience in corporate finance and understand how financial decisions are made within a business environment.

What types of projects and tasks can a Financial Planning Analysis Intern expect to work on during their internship?

As a Financial Planning Analysis Intern, you can expect to assist with budgeting, forecasting, and financial reporting activities. Interns often help analyze financial data, prepare variance analyses, and support month-end closing processes. You may also collaborate with cross-functional teams, such as accounting or business operations, to gather data and provide insights that inform decision-making. These experiences offer valuable exposure to financial modeling and can build foundational skills for a career in finance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Financial Planning Analysis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Financial Planning Analysis Intern, you need a solid grasp of accounting principles, financial modeling, and data analysis, usually supported by coursework in finance, accounting, or a related field. Familiarity with Microsoft Excel, financial reporting software, and sometimes ERP systems like SAP is typically required.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ication skills help interns excel in this role. These skills are crucial for producing accurate financial insights, supporting decision-making, and contributing to a company's strategic planning.

The Manager of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) is a key leader within the Corporate Finance Department, providing strategic financial leadership and decision support to executive and operational leadership across the healthcare organization. Reporting to the Director of Corporate Finance, this position oversees financ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, management reporting, and service line financial analysis to support the organization's strategic and operational objectives. The Manager leads and develops a team of finance and service line analysts and serves as a trusted business partner to clinical and administrative leaders. Responsibilities include directing the annual operating and capital budget processes, coordinating financial forecasts, supporting long-range business planning, and ensuring the timely preparation of executive financial reports, dashboards, and service line performance analyses. This role oversees monthly variance analysis and financial reporting in support of the month-end close process, identifies key performance drivers, and communicates actionable financial insights to senior leadership. The Manager develops financial models, business cases, ROI analyses, and pro forma evaluations to support strategic initiatives, capital investments, service line growth, and other organizational priorities. Success in this role requires strong knowledge of healthcare finance, budgeting, financial reporting, and business planning, along with exceptional analytical, leadership, and communication skills. The position exercises a high degree of independent judgment, initiative, accuracy, and collaboration to drive financial performance and support informed decision-making throughout the organization. 


Responsibilities:
1. Manages service line analytics across the Hospital and presents financial analysis to executive leadership. Identifies trends and opportunities for gaining competitive advantage in the marketplace. Supervises the service line and finance analysts and directs daily workflow. Completes the annual review process for supervised analysts.
2. Oversees the preparation of the annual operating and capital budget, in coordination with the Director. Specific area of focus will be forecasting revenues and expenses and facilitating the evaluation/inclusion of proposed business plans in the operating and capital budgets. Leads and manages the departmental budget trainings and serves as the point of contact to managers and directors during budget preparation.
3. Conducts complex analysis on large data sets and develops regular and ad-hoc reports and for hospital leadership to assist in the decision-making process; manages the design and creation of complex, dynamic financial models to facilitate decision-making by senior leadership; and researches, collects, manipulates and analyzes data; draws inferences, summarizes and presents key findings to Director and Senior Management for assigned topics.
4. Forecasts revenues and expenses and researches ways to enhance hospital revenues and control costs. Manages the implementation of financial improvements and tracks achievement of objectives. Creates and evaluates cash flow models using NPV analysis for business planning for potential new service lines and business units. Maintains the organization's financial forecast models and administers the financial reporting system.
5. Under the direction of the Director, Corporate Finance, serves as the primary financial planner and analyst for the Rex President and Chief Executive Officer and Chief Financial Officer to ensure consistency and accuracy in financial reporting and presentations. Reviews organization?s financial reports, identifying trends and opportunities for performance improvement. Compares key financial indicators to those of competitors.
6. Manages cross-functional service line teams to produce business plans for new business initiatives and operational improvements for review by Management. Includes conducting financial feasibility studies, preparing project plans, analyzing potential operations, and identifying steps for implementation. Manages service line analysts and works closely with department managers to generate ideas and prepare assessments of business opportunities for new services or technologies.
7. Manages the compilation of market and operational analyses in coordination with department Leadership, to support the budget and strategic planning process. Includes collecting, organizing, and interpreting large quantities of complex data.Serves as a liaison between the department and clinical service line teams, representing the resources of the Department and providing specialist knowledge in assigned area of expertise. Develops and maintains positive working relationships with internal and external clients.
8. Designs and creates analytical models to ensure achievement of objectives and exercises independent judgment in model design and development; Designs models to demonstrate impact of regulatory changes and proposes strategic alternatives to departmental leadership; Tracks and models population and volume growth trends and health care utilization. Projects demand for services using complex spreadsheet analysis and regression models. Incorporates data from online market information system, State hospital databases, and other sources as appropriate. Researches developments in health care technologies to determine impact on service utilization, future hospital volumes and profitability. Assesses competitor service development and performance. Identifies and directs the compilation of operating and financial data on key competitors and provides trend analyses and ad-hoc reports of statistics.
9. Monitors development of annual State Medical Facilities Plan, Licensure and Facilities rules and other regulations affecting health care planning. Drafts narrative and analytical arguments for certificate of need applications and other requests to regulatory agencies.
10. Evaluates internal and external data on physician activity, identifying trends and opportunities for improvements in volume and revenue. Creates and updates trend reports of physician practice for operational and physician relations staff. Develops, implements and reports on surveys of physician satisfaction, consumer trends, and internal surveys as necessary. Prepares evaluation of vendor proposals and makes recommendations to department Leadership.
11. Manages new business plan development to include assessment of new business plan development and performance. Compares operating and financial data on business plans in implementation and reports on their performance against projections.

Education Requirements:
Bachelor's degree required. Master's degree or equivalent, MBA or MHA preferred.
Licensure/Certification Requirements:
No licensure or certification required.
Professional Experience Requirements:
Six to eight years of experience in a related healthcare role. Minimum of four years of direct financial analysis experience through a combination of education and professional experience.
If an Associate's degree: 10 years of experience.
If a High School diploma or GED: 14 years of experience.
Knowledge/Skills/and Abilities Requirements:
Language Skills: Ability to read, analyze, and interpret financial reports, medical device publications, and legal contracts. Ability to respond to inquiries or complaints from senior management, regulatory agencies, or members of the business community. Ability to write reports and executive summaries in a concise, professional manner. Ability to effectively present information to top management, public groups, and/or boards of directors. Technical Skills: Advanced Excel, PowerPoint and Access skills required. Ability to create dynamic models and complex analysis on large data sets. Experience with reporting tools such as Business Objects and financial and operational reporting systems preferred. Mathematical Skills: Ability to apply mathematical concepts such as exponents, frequency distribution, analysis of variance, correlation techniques, and basic statistics. Finance Skills: Advanced understanding of cash flow modeling, NPV analysis, financial statement relationships, and capital planning and evaluation. Ability to forecast future operational volumes and revenues and expenses. Reasoning Ability: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w well thought out conclusions. Ability to interpret an extensive variety of technical instructions in mathematical or diagram form and deal with several abstract and concrete variables.
